1. Produkt Overview

The Schneider Square Inductor Proximity Switch is a reliable and precise sensor designed for industrial automation applications. It detects the presence of metallic objects without physical contact, offering various configurations including NPN and PNP outputs, and Normally Open (NO) or Normally Closed (NC) contact types. This manual provides essential information for the safe and effective installation, operation, and maintenance of your proximity switch.

2.2 Wiring Diagrams

The proximity switch operates on a DC 10-30V power supply (specifically 12-24VDC as shown in diagrams) and features a three-wire connection. Carefully follow the wiring instructions for your specific model (NPN/PNP, Normally Open/Normally Closed).

2.2.1 XS8S173NAL2C (NPN Normally Open)

Wiring diagram for XS8S173NAL2C NPN Normally Open proximity switch

Figure 2: Wiring for XS8S173NAL2C (NPN NO).

  • Brún (BN): Connect to +12V to +24V DC power supply.
  • Blue (BU): Connect to 0V (Ground).
  • Swart (BK): Connect to NPN Normally Open output. This output will switch to 0V when a metallic object is detected.

2.2.2 XS8S173NBL2C (NPN Normally Closed)

Wiring diagram for XS8S173NBL2C NPN Normally Closed proximity switch

Figure 3: Wiring for XS8S173NBL2C (NPN NC).

  • Brún (BN): Connect to +12V to +24V DC power supply.
  • Blue (BU): Connect to 0V (Ground).
  • Swart (BK): Connect to NPN Normally Closed output. This output will switch to 0V when no metallic object is detected, and open when detected.

2.2.3 XS8S173PAL2C (PNP Normally Open)

Wiring diagram for XS8S173PAL2C PNP Normally Open proximity switch

Figure 4: Wiring for XS8S173PAL2C (PNP NO).

  • Brún (BN): Connect to +12V to +24V DC power supply.
  • Blue (BU): Connect to 0V (Ground).
  • Swart (BK): Connect to PNP Normally Open output. This output will switch to +V (supply voltage) when a metallic object is detected.

3. Bedriuwsinstruksjes

The proximity switch operates by detecting changes in an electromagnetic field when a metallic object enters its sensing range. The output state changes based on whether the object is present and the sensor's configuration (Normally Open or Normally Closed).

  • Normaal iepen (NO): The output is OFF (open circuit for NPN, 0V for PNP) when no object is detected. The output turns ON (0V for NPN, +V for PNP) when a metallic object enters the sensing range.
  • Normally Closed (NC): The output is ON (0V for NPN, +V for PNP) when no object is detected. The output turns OFF (open circuit for NPN, 0V for PNP) when a metallic object enters the sensing range.
  • Ensure the target object is metallic and passes within 5mm of the sensor's face for reliable detection.

4. Underhâld

The Schneider proximity switch is designed for long-term, maintenance-free operation under normal industrial conditions. However, periodic checks can help ensure optimal performance:

  • Keep the sensing face clean and free from excessive dust, debris, or metallic shavings that could interfere with detection.
  • Inspect the cable for any signs of damage, cuts, or fraying.
  • Verify that the mounting is secure and the sensor has not shifted position.
  • Ensure the operating temperature and voltage remain within specified limits.

5. Probleemoplossing

If the proximity switch is not functioning as expected, consider the following:

  • No detection:
    • Check power supply connections (Brown to +, Blue to -).
    • Verify the target object is metallic and within the 5mm sensing distance.
    • Ensure the sensor face is clean and unobstructed.
    • Confirm correct wiring for NPN/PNP and NO/NC configurations.
  • False detection or erratic behavior:
    • Check for nearby metallic objects or strong electromagnetic interference.
    • Soargje derfoar dat de sensor feilich monteard is en net trilt.
    • Verify the power supply is stable and within the specified voltage berik.
  • Output always ON/OFF:
    • Re-check the wiring against the specific model's diagram (NO vs. NC).
    • Test the sensor with a known metallic object to confirm its basic functionality.
